Built In Cabinetry Staining in Kokomo, IN

Built-in cabinetry staining services involve applying a durable stain to existing custom cabinets to enhance their appearance and highlight the wood’s natural beauty. This process is suitable for a variety of projects, including kitchen and bathroom cabinets, built-in bookcases, entertainment centers, and other custom storage solutions. Homeowners often seek staining to achieve a specific color tone, restore a worn finish, or update the look of their cabinetry without replacing the entire unit. Understanding the types of wood, stain options, and the desired final look can help property owners make informed decisions before requesting this service.

Before requesting built-in cabinetry staining, property owners typically want to consider the current condition of their cabinets, including any existing finishes, scratches, or damage that may affect the staining process. It’s also important to think about the color and style preferences, as stains can range from light and natural to dark and dramatic. Proper pre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, is essential to ensure an even and long-lasting finish. Clarifying these details can help ensure the final result meets expectations and enhances the overall aesthetic of the space.

FAQ

Built In Cabinetry Staining Questions

What types of cabinets can be stained? Staining services typically cover built-in kitchen, bathroom, and custom cabinetry to enhance their appearance and durability.

Is staining suitable for all cabinet finishes? Staining works best on bare or lightly finished wood surfaces; heavily painted or laminated cabinets may require different treatments.

Can staining change the color of existing cabinets? Yes, staining can alter the color and highlight the natural wood grain, providing a fresh look without replacing the cabinets.

What should property owners consider before staining cabinets? Proper surface preparation and choosing the right stain type are key to achieving a desired finish and long-lasting results.
